- Dasya-rasa -
- relationship of servitorship with the Supreme Lord.
-
- Deity -
- see Arca
Vigraha
-
- Devaki --
- the wife of VASUDEVA and
mother of Lord Krishna.
-
- Devi--
- used to denote a female with auspicious or divine
qualities, As a name refers to DURGA.
-
- dharma-
- the eternal function of the living entity.
-
- Dhira--
- one who is not disturbed by material illusion.
-
- Dhrtarastra--
- the father who collaborated with his sons to cheat the PANDAVA brothers of their
kingdom and fight against them in the Battle of KURUKSETRA.
-
- Drona-
- the military teacher of the PANDAVA
brothers who was obliged to fight against them in the
Battle of KURUKSETRA.
-
- Dhuma--
- Dark, moonless fortnight. Those who die during this
opportune period for death may rise up to higher planets,
only to return again, after death, to the earthly planet.
-
- Diksa--
- spiritual initiation in to the chanting of a mantra given by a spiritual master.
-
- Duratma--
- a cripple-minded person who is under the control of the
external potency or the illusory energy (maya) of the Supreme Lord.
-
- Durga--
- the personified material energy of the Lord, and the wife
of the demigod SIVA.
-
- Duryodhana--
- the son of DHRTARASTRA who led
the fight against the PANDAVA
brothers in the Battle of KURUKSETRA,
stated in the Mahabharata
to be the incarnation of evil.
-
- Dvija-bandhu--
- one born in a brahmana family but not qualified as a brahmana.
